How to Choose a Bunk Bed Single Bunk beds can be an excellent option for a bedroom It is important to choose the right bunk bed This article will assist you in selecting the ideal single bunk bed for your space A few of our top choices include a pullout trundle which can be used as a second bed for guests or kids who stay over They also come with an inbuilt ladder that is safer and more userfriendly than the standard ladder for bunk beds Size Bunk beds are a great option to make space in a bedroom They provide additional space to set up furniture or for letting your children play They also come in a variety of designs and sizes to suit your needs and budget When choosing a bunk bed it is crucial to take into account the size of the room and the ceilings height The ideal bunk size is one that will not hinder the ability to walk or limit headroom It should be made of sturdy materials that are safe for your child to sleep in Typically bunk beds consist of two beds that are safely placed above one another They are suitable for teens adults and children They are available in different designs including twin over queen and twin over full They are suitable for rooms with high or low ceilings They are also ideal for college dorms Some bunk beds are designed to be separated into separate beds later This feature is particularly beneficial for children who grow out of their bunks very quickly This kind of bunk bed is available in both wood and metal and may include a trundle for extra storage or builtin drawers Before you purchase a bunk bed its important to ask your children if they are capable of deciding their own bed This will allow them to learn to make decisions independently and help them think about their own choices Talk to your doctor for children with special needs The most common size of bunk beds is twin over twin This is the ideal option for smaller rooms The bunk bed is available in many colors and finishes that will match any interior design If you have more space you can select a twin over full bunk bed or even a futon bunk bed Bunk beds can be an excellent option for bedrooms shared by multiple people and can help you save money by removing the need to purchase two separate mattresses and foundationsbox springs Style Style could be more important to you than the size when it comes bunk beds The bunk beds design determines how it fits into the room and what its features are Bunk beds come in many different styles ranging from the basic twotiered bunks to the large set pieces that take over half of a room Some bunk beds come with a desk and a study space Additionally there are a variety of different building materials that you can pick from Some of these options include metal which is less expensive than wood and is more flexible Others such as solid wood are more expensive but are more durable single bunk beds oversingle style is among the most popular This type of bunk is ideal for rooms with multiple children and is able to be fitted with twin mattresses The ladder can be found from either side of the bed which makes it easier for both children to get in and out of bed Another style is the rustic bunk bed which is designed to resemble an oldfashioned log cabin This kind of bunk bed usually has a the look of a handcrafted piece and is constructed from topquality natural materials Its also simple to keep clean as it does not require special finishes or paints Consider a metal bunk with stairs if you want something that is more contemporary This style is ideal for older children college students and adults Its also available in a broad variety of colors and finishes so you can customize it to match your decor The triple bunk is a third option that can be great for rooms with high ceilings This type of bunk bed is generally constructed from solid hardwood and can be set up according to your space It is also important to measure the walls height prior to purchasing bunk beds If your ceilings are too low you may prefer a loft bed instead Triple bunk beds are a great option for children or adults who do not want to share a bedroom but require more space These beds are often paired up with a desk which helps kids stay focused and organized when they are doing their homework and schoolwork Safety Bunk beds are a great way to save space in the bedroom of your child and keep them in close proximity but if they are not maintained properly they can be dangerous Parents should follow the instructions provided by the manufacturer for proper maintenance and use of safe cleaning products to keep their childrens bunk beds looking nice and functioning safely Parents should also check the dimensions of the bunk bed to ensure they fit in the space available in their childs bedroom A bunk bed that is too big can hinder the childrens movements and cause accidents Additionally if a mattress is too thick on the top bunk it may not fit inside the guard rails and can expose children to the risk of falling off the bed Consider hiring a professional if youre unsure of the best way to measure your space They will make sure that your bunk bed is the ideal size for your space and assist you in selecting the right mattress They can also assist you to install the bunk bed safely Aside from regular maintenance bunk beds should be placed away from things that could interfere with the view of children in the upper bunk like curtain cords blinds windows ceiling fans and lighting fixtures In addition its crucial to ensure that the ladder is not placed too close to the edge of the bed The ladder can become a danger if a child falls off the bunk bed The bottom of the top bunk should be connected directly to the headboard or footboard of the lower bunk This will stop the upper bunk from swaying and swaying which could cause a trip hazard Parents should also educate their children not to climb on the sides of the bed and to rest in the middle of the top bunk It is also important to keep the ladder free of clothing toys and other clutter and to fix it to the bunk bed Children should be taught to use the ladder only when they are ready to bed and should not be play with it Cost Bunk beds are an excellent way to save space in bedrooms that are small They also make sleepovers and shared rooms enjoyable and easy to manage They come in a variety of configurations so theres an ideal bunk bed for every family and budget It is essential to determine the size of the space where you intend to put your bunk bed before purchasing it This will ensure it fits perfectly and is safe to be used It is recommended to consult a professional to avoid any mistakes One advantage of a bunk bed is that it allows two people to share a room without having to worry about securing a separate desk or nightstand This is especially beneficial if your child is a teenager who wants to study with a group of friends Bunk beds are a great option for older children who need their own space These beds can be constructed with a desk drawers and other features to suit your requirements When you are deciding on the ideal bunk bed for your kids It is crucial to think about the mattresss dimensions Most bunk beds can accommodate twin or fullsized mattresses You can purchase a combination Based on the size of your room you could even add a trundle This is a separate sleeping platform that can be pulled out from under the bunk Adding a bunk bed to your home is a smart investment It will not only offer your children more space to sleep but also help them feel more confident It will also provide them with the privacy and independence they require to focus on their studies Additionally it will allow them to keep their schedules in order If youre considering buying a bed make sure it is made from sturdy materials Make sure to check for security features on the bed for instance a guardrail at the top bunk The beds height will also affect the comfort of the mattress Moreover it is crucial to consider the size of the bunk bed when choosing the mattress
